What is the difference between Freelance 3D Simulation vs 3D Animator?

AspectFreelance 3D Simulation3D Animator
CredentialsProficiency in simulation software, 3D modeling, and programmingSkills in animation software, storytelling, and character design
Work EnvironmentFreelance projects, remote or on-site, often for technical simulationsStudio or freelance, focusing on character and scene animation
Industry UsageEngineering, training, virtual prototypingEntertainment, advertising, gaming
Search & ComparisonOften compared for technical vs creative roles in 3D

Freelance 3D Simulation specialists focus on creating realistic simulations for technical and engineering purposes, requiring programming and modeling skills. 3D Animators primarily craft animated characters and scenes for entertainment or marketing. While both roles involve 3D software, their applications, skills, and industries differ significantly.

Job description

Company Description
Ledet training is a chain of instructor-led computer software training centers in the USA. We have been authorized training vendors for Adobe, Autodesk, Unity, Microsoft and other major software vendors for over 20 years.
The company operates bricks and mortar facilities in Atlanta, Chicago, Denver, San Diego and Washington DC, as well as high quality online training in virtual classrooms and onsite training services delivered at customer locations worldwide.
Job Description
Contract trainers are sought for all levels of Unity 3D training, intro through advanced with a focus on serious games, AEC (Architecture Engineering and Construction), simulation, and elearning, as well as game development.
This is a contract 1099 opportunity ideal for independent freelance development professionals seeking to supplement their business income with fairly regular opportunities to deliver classroom based instruction.
Classes are typically 2 to 5 days long. Class times are 9:00 to 4:00 with a one hour lunch break. Instructors are expected to arrive by 8:00 and be prepared to stay up to an hour later, if necessary, to answer customer questions or assist them with any challenges. Classes are delivered during the business work week. We do not offer classes on evenings or weekends.
Students are typically currently employed adult business professionals whose employer is paying for the professional skills development.
Daily Rates
As independent contractors, trainers can set their own pay rate. Different instructors charge different rates, but typically those contractors who set their daily rate competitive with others in the industry have more training opportunities presented to them. Their are approximately six hours of classroom delivery per day, but time must be budgeted for preparation and setup. Pay is competitive and rates are negotiable.
